BSF troops foil infiltration attempt; 5 B’deshis held

SHILLONG, April 1: Border Security Force (BSF) Meghalaya Frontier troops on Monday apprehended five Bangladeshi nationals near Pyrdwah village in East Khasi Hills while they were attempting to infiltrate into Indian territory. Two Indian nationals were also arrested for aiding their illegal entry by transporting them in a taxi.
According to a statement here, alert troops of the 4 Bn BSF Meghalaya, acting on specific intelligence, had intercepted the movement of the Bangladeshi nationals and detained them.
All the apprehended individuals have been handed over to Pynursla Police Station in East Khasi Hills for further legal action.
It may be mentioned that in recent times, BSF has intensified intelligence gathering and operations along the border to curb infiltration attempts.
On Saturday, BSF personnel had apprehended one Bangladeshi national attempting to infiltrate into Indian territory through the East Jaintia Hills border.
